find an element in the aray and if it is not found , return the element just greater than the element we are trying to search.
Java Technical Lead Interview Questions
595 java technical lead interview questions shared by candidates
1st Technical consist of question like:- 1.) Design pattern- GOF, Singleton, Builder, Factory ect. 2.) A simple java program used for sorting. 3.) Aggregation vs Composition 4.) Core java questions-- String pool, prepared statement, heap, Maps, Hashing. etc. Both Client Round was scenario based and only Multi Threading was asked:- It was tough for me as i had never worked on multi threading. Was of same level.
3rd Question was from Java Collections. Given a List of Object, which can contain Integers and also contain List which internally can again contain List to nth Level. Write a utility method which would return a flat List.
They need to first join the call to ask questions
1. Solid principles 2. Singleton pattern, in case if we pass hashmap- map can be altered and it will destroy singleton, how to handle that 3. How to create threads 4. How to execute 10 threads at a time 5. How to create global exception class 6. When to use arraylist and linkedlist 7. Completable in java 8 8. What's changed in hashmap in java 8 9. Deep copying and shallow copying 10. Use of volatile keyword in java 11. Programming a. String ="I love programming" -we need to count the length and arrange it in desc but that should be return as string using stream api b. List in = Arrays.asList(1,3,7,0,6,7,8,0); need to sort this and put only 0 at first and let the remaining stay as it is using stream API
very basic java question
They asked more about the project
Design patterns you used and scenario?
Pair programming on an easy LeetCode question.
1. System Design Youtube 2. Microservice communication (in depth) 3. Java Stream API 4. Handle duplicate call
Viewing 571 - 580 interview questions